Synopsis :

Haunted by a personal tragedy, home care worker Shoo is sent to a remote village to care for an agoraphobic woman who fears the neighbours as much as she fears the Na Sídhe – sinister entities who she believes abducted her decades before. As the two develop a strangely deep connection, Shoo is consumed by the old woman’s paranoia, rituals, and superstitions, eventually confronting the horrors from her own past.


Directors Bio :

Aislinn Clarke is an Irish writer and director. She holds the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ences Gold Fellowship for Women. She is also the first Irish woman to have made a horror feature film, The Devil's Doorway (2018).
